Crime Dramas New Year’s Resolutions Day 1: What to expect and the full schedule
The new year is a chance to look back and assess, making changes for the year ahead. We’re looking at the TV crime dramas and resolutions they should make.
We’re at the time of the year where it’s out with the old and in with the new. It’s the time of year we look back at what worked and what didn’t, looking at changes that are needed in the year ahead. Throughout the month of January, we’re using the time to look at the various TV crime dramas out there.
Each day, we’ll pick a different TV crime drama and share our one New Year’s Resolution that the drama should make. It could be a change in a specific element of the writing or a wish for a certain character or two.
